How to Choose the Right High Pressure Diesel SAE100r Fuel Hose Pipe

When it comes to choosing the right high-pressure diesel SAE100r fuel hose pipe for industrial applications, there are several factors to consider. These hoses are essential for transferring fuel and other fluids in high-pressure environments, so it is crucial to select a hose that is durable, reliable, and meets the specific requirements of your operation.

One of the first things to consider when choosing a high-pressure diesel fuel hose pipe is the material it is made from. Industrial fuel oil hydraulic rubber hoses are a popular choice for high-pressure applications due to their durability and flexibility. These hoses are designed to withstand the high pressures and temperatures associated with fuel transfer, making them ideal for industrial use.

In addition to the material, it is important to consider the size and length of the hose pipe. The size of the hose will determine the flow rate and pressure capacity, so it is essential to choose a hose that is the right size for your specific application. Additionally, the length of the hose will depend on the distance the fuel needs to be transferred, so be sure to measure the distance accurately before selecting a hose.

Another important factor to consider when choosing a high-pressure diesel fuel hose pipe is the pressure rating. The SAE100r standard is a common rating system used to classify hoses based on their pressure capacity. It is essential to choose a hose with a pressure rating that meets or exceeds the maximum pressure of your application to ensure safe and efficient fuel transfer.

When selecting a high-pressure diesel fuel hose pipe, it is also important to consider the temperature rating. Industrial applications often involve high temperatures, so it is crucial to choose a hose that can withstand these extreme conditions without degrading or failing. Look for hoses that are rated for high temperatures to ensure reliable performance in your operation.

In addition to the material, size, pressure rating, and temperature rating, it is also important to consider the end fittings of the hose pipe. The end fittings are crucial for connecting the hose to other components in the fuel transfer system, so be sure to choose fittings that are compatible with your equipment and provide a secure connection.
